RemotEye II Features

Included in the RemotEye II are several support options for managing Toshiba UPS.
BOOTP/DHCP Requests
The RemotEye II can automatically retrieve its network identity from a network server using the Boot
Protocol (BOOTP) or Dynamic Host Configuration (DHCP) automatic configuration technique.
HTTP Web Access
Web access includes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) Configurations. This allows users to access data from
RemotEye publicly or privately using the web.
Telnet, Terminal Access
Telnet includes Secure Shell (SSH) protocol configuration.
SNMP Access
RemotEye II provides enhanced SNMP security with option of SNMPv3, default protocol is SNMPv1. It is
compatible with the United States Standard UPS MIB, RFC1628 and also with Japanese Standard UPS
MIB.
Additional features of the RemotEye II include:
Real-Time Clock
The RemotEye II contains its own RTC. This clock is used for time-stamping of its data log and for
executing any scheduled events.
UPS Event Notification
RemotEye II sends out notification of UPS events via Email, SNMP Traps and Java Applets.
Graphic User Interface (GUI)
User-friendly GUI for web pages and Java applets
Power Quality Monitor
Java applets provide on-screen visual indication of power quality through dynamic graphics.
Versatile Remote UPS Management
Allows monitoring of the UPS via SNMP and HTTP communication. Also provides Java monitoring
applets accessible through an internet browser.
Versatile UPS Configuration
RemotEye II has the ability to set the UPS parameters from any SNMP management station or through
internet web browsers using HTTP forms and objects.
Data Log Retention
RemotEye II stores history file containing UPS power events, power quality, UPS status, and battery
condition in non-volatile memory.
Automatic UPS Shutdown
The Toshiba RemotEye II Client Software provides unattended and on-demand UPS shutdown; either
pre-programmed by the administrator or when the UPS reports a low battery condition.
